anyquery is One SQL interface for 60+ tools (e.g., GitHub, Notion, Airtable). Plug into any LLM through MCP.. It is categorized as a MCP Server with 1.7k GitHub stars.
anyquery is primarily written in Go. It covers topics such as ai, analytics, api.
